Mr. Siirala’s debut recording of Schubert transcriptions for Naxos in 2003 received outstanding reviews. The following year, his recording of works by Brahms for Ondine received Gramophone Magazine’s “Editor’s Choice” award, and the highest rating in the category of interpretation from Piano News.



At the heart of Antti Siirala’s repertoire are the compositions of Beethoven and Brahms. This season, he continues his cycle of the complete Beethoven piano works at the Sibelius Academy in Helsinki.
